National Assembly Chair urges Prime Minister to hold elections 35 days before members’ term ends



KATHMANDU: National Assembly Chair Narayan Prasad Dahal met with Prime Minister Sushila Karki to discuss the upcoming National Assembly elections.

During the meeting held at the Prime Minister’s Office in Singha Durbar on Sunday, Chair Dahal informed Prime Minister Karki that the term of one-third of National Assembly members will expire on March 4, and as per legal provisions, the election should be conducted 35 days prior to that date.

Following the meeting, Chair Dahal said discussions also covered the issue of convening the next National Assembly session. He informed that preparations are underway to call the meeting after the reconstruction of the Parliament building in Baneshwor, which was damaged during the Gen-Z protests.

The two also discussed pending bills under consideration in the National Assembly. During the meeting, Prime Minister Karki emphasized the need for collective efforts to move the country forward in the current situation, Dahal added.
